Transaction 51ebeae84b9234a4c0dc141b7329cade858bfcb782b23d644e15a536bfc4b43b
1 Input
2 Outputs
- 51ebeae84b9234a4c0dc141b7329cade858bfcb782b23d644e15a536bfc4b43b:0
- 51ebeae84b9234a4c0dc141b7329cade858bfcb782b23d644e15a536bfc4b43b:1
value 27977
address 16agKRj6N7yJPMvVqVYAbCzosH8sQkfKpw
value 4855923
address 1HbpnsF2ay3egFYxkAmRGgKk6b6mwkd5r1